| Alb is albumin, which has nothing to do with drug testing but instead is a screen to see ig you have any kidney disease causing you to leak protein into your urine. Tha fasting is important so your cholesterol panel can be measured accurately. None of the steps in dilution would affect this, so you can still dilute, just don't eat anything befoer the test (or drink fatty milk or cream in coffee). If you're pounding gatorade for dilution, there's a small chance your "fasting" bloodsugar wlll be above 126 mg/dl, which is the fasting cutoff for diabetes, but this is unlikely given your young age.

| A rapid drug test is an instant test. Much like, or exactly like the tests you use at home. Some have integrity checks for specific gravity, Ph and Oxidants using a color chart. You can dilute heavily with an instant test, but just like the laboratory tests, you can go overboard with the dilution. If you screen negative, then you will know right away. If your instant test screens non-negative, (anything other than a flat out negative), then they should send the specimen into a lab for confirmation. Some employers do not do this and if you screen non-negative with an instant test, that is it. finished. final. this happens (I guess) about 5%-10% of the time. |
